数据库备份实操教程视频指南
数据库备份教程视频

首页 2025-04-10 16:01:35



数据库备份教程视频:确保数据安全不可或缺的一课 在当今这个信息化时代,数据已成为企业最宝贵的资产之一

    无论是金融、医疗、教育还是电子商务,各行各业都依赖于数据进行决策、运营和服务

    然而,数据面临的风险也随之增加,自然灾害、硬件故障、人为错误、黑客攻击等,都可能导致数据丢失或损坏

    因此,掌握数据库备份技术,确保数据的安全与可恢复性,是每个企业IT人员及数据管理者不可或缺的技能

    本文将结合“数据库备份教程视频”的内容,深入探讨数据库备份的重要性、基本原则、常见方法以及实战操作指南,旨在帮助读者构建一套高效、可靠的备份体系

     一、数据库备份的重要性 数据库备份是指将数据库中的全部或部分数据复制到另一个存储介质(如硬盘、磁带、云存储等)的过程,以便在原始数据丢失或损坏时能够迅速恢复

    其重要性体现在以下几个方面: 1.灾难恢复:面对自然灾害、硬件故障等不可抗力,备份是唯一的数据恢复手段,能够最大限度减少业务中断时间

     2.数据保护:防止因人为错误(如误删除)、恶意攻击(如勒索软件)导致的数据丢失,保障数据完整性

     3.合规性要求:许多行业和法规要求企业定期备份数据,以满足审计、法律诉讼等需求

     4.业务连续性:确保在遭遇数据问题时,企业能够快速恢复运营,维护客户信任和市场竞争力

     二、数据库备份的基本原则 在着手进行数据库备份之前,明确几个基本原则至关重要: 1.定期性:根据数据变化频率和业务需求,制定合理的备份计划,如每日增量备份、每周全量备份等

     2.冗余性:备份数据应存储在至少两个不同的物理位置,以防单点故障

     3.安全性:备份数据应加密存储,并严格控制访问权限,防止未经授权的访问和泄露

     4.可测试性:定期测试备份数据的有效性,确保在需要时能够成功恢复

     5.自动化:采用自动化备份工具,减少人为错误,提高备份效率和可靠性

     三、数据库备份的常见方法 数据库备份方法多样,根据具体需求和技术环境选择最合适的方式: 1.全量备份:复制数据库中的所有数据,适用于数据量较小或数据变化不大的场景

     2.增量备份:仅备份自上次备份以来发生变化的数据,减少备份时间和存储空间需求

     3.差异备份:备份自上次全量备份以来所有发生变化的数据,介于全量和增量之间,恢复时效率较高

     4.快照备份:利用存储系统的快照功能,创建数据库在某一时刻的镜像,快速且对业务影响小

     5.镜像复制:实时或准实时地将数据从一个数据库复制到另一个数据库,实现高可用性和灾难恢复

     四、实战操作指南:通过教程视频学习数据库备份 为了更直观地理解并掌握数据库备份技能,推荐观看高质量的“数据库备份教程视频”

    以下是一个基于视频内容的实战操作指南概要,以MySQL数据库为例: 1. 准备阶段 - 环境搭建:确保MySQL服务器运行正常,创建一个测试数据库用于备份练习

     - 工具选择:MySQL自带的mysqldump工具是初学者友好的选择,适用于小型数据库;对于大型数据库,可考虑使用MySQL Enterprise Backup或第三方工具

     2. 全量备份操作 - 命令行操作:打开命令行界面,使用`mysqldump`命令执行全量备份

    例如:`mysqldump -u 【用户名】 -p【密码】 【数据库名】 >【备份文件路径】`

     - 视频演示:观看视频,学习如何正确输入命令、处理密码提示、以及检查备份文件是否生成

     3. 增量/差异备份操作 - 配置二进制日志:启用MySQL的二进制日志功能,记录所有更改数据的SQL语句,是实现增量/差异备份的基础

     - 执行备份:使用mysqlbinlog工具结合二进制日志文件,提取增量数据

    视频中将详细展示如何定位日志位置、执行增量备份命令

     4. 备份恢复操作 - 全量恢复:使用mysql命令导入备份文件,恢复数据库

    例如:`mysql -u【用户名】 -p【密码】【数据库名】< 【备份文件路径】`

     - 增量/差异恢复:先恢复全量备份,再依次应用增量/差异备份文件

    视频中将演示如何按顺序恢复,确保数据一致性

     5. 自动化备份设置 - Cron作业:在Linux系统中,利用Cron服务设置定时任务,自动执行备份脚本

    视频将指导如何编辑Cron表、编写并执行备份脚本

     - 第三方工具:介绍一些流行的自动化备份工具,如Percona XtraBackup、BackupPC等,展示其配置和使用方法

     五、总结与反思 通过“数据库备份教程视频”的学习,我们不仅掌握了数据库备份的基本概念和原则,还学会了多种备份方法及其实际操作步骤

    重要的是,我们要意识到,备份不是一次性的任务,而是一个持续的过程,需要定期评估备份策略的有效性,根据业务发展和技术变化进行调整

     此外,备份数据的管理和维护同样重要

    定期清理过期备份,确保存储空间的有效利用;加密存储备份数据,加强访问控制,保护数据安全

    同时,建立灾难恢复计划,并进行模拟演练,确保在真实灾难发生时能够迅速响应,有效恢复业务运行

     总之,数据库备份是企业数据安全的基石,是每个IT人员必须掌握的核心技能

    通过不断学习和实践,我们能够构建更加健壮、高效的数据保护体系,为企业的发展保驾护航

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道